Normal weather worksheets specifically tailored for 3-year-olds offer a colorful and engaging way to introduce the young minds to the wonders of weather around them. At this tender age, children are naturally curious, soaking up information with eagerness. These worksheets serve as a perfect tool to channel their curiosity in a structured yet playful manner.
Understanding the basics of weather - from sunny days to rainy afternoons - is not just educational but also immensely practical. Through these worksheets, 3-year-olds begin to make sense of their environment. They learn to identify different types of weather, comprehend the significance of various weather symbols, and even start to dress accordingly. This foundational knowledge enhances their observational skills, a key component in the early development stages.
Moreover, normal weather worksheets for 3-year-olds are designed with their developmental stage in mind. The activities are simple, requiring basic recognition and matching skills, making learning both achievable and fun. They also incorporate bright colors and engaging illustrations to hold the child's attention, making the learning process enjoyable.
